Title: Super Eagles : Several seconds, few firsts
Post by: Folami David on Jan 19, 2013, 11:29 AM
Nigeria may have won the Africa Cup of Nations title just twice, but when it comes to podium finishes their track is second to none in Africa.
.
The Super Eagles have finished among the top three positions in 13 of their 16 appearances so far : winning the title in 1980 and 1994, finishing second four times, and bagging the bronze medal seven times.
.
The only exceptions were 1963 and 1982 when they were eliminated in the first round, and in 2008 when they lost out in the quater-finals.
.
In contrast, Africa's most successful side Egypt, who have seven titles to their name, have ended on the podium 11 times in 22 appearances.
